Say hi, tell us how you found us, and give us some suggestions on things you'd love to hear.   Walkabout The World is a weekly Disney podcast, always recorded on property at Walt Disney World or Disneyland Resort with the simple goal of making you feel like you are in the middle of the magic.

Please welcome Walt Disney World Ambassadors, Ali Manion and Rayvon Reggie. Well, good morning and welcome and happy Earth Day! Wow, what a crowd. Thank you all so much for being here to celebrate this very special occasion.
Starting point is 00:16:35 That's right, Rayvon. 25 years ago today, we opened the gates of this beautiful park for the very first time. And at the opening of those gates, Disney's Animal Kingdom has been at the core of our conservation efforts right here at Walt Disney World Resort. And all over the globe, there are animals that are thriving because of the very work that we are doing right here in this park. It's because of our cast members. Yes, let's hear it for it! And it's because of our cast members that we've been able to share the magic of nature
Starting point is 00:17:08 with millions of guests. And some of those favorites include the Kilimanjaro Safari or the Festival of the Lion King and more recently, Avatar Flight of Passage. Ray Goddard has taken a lot of people to make the last 25 years possible. From our Imagineers, to our cast members, to each and every guest who visits Disney's Animal Kingdom.
